가수면

줄 정리 본문

일지

줄 정리

니비앙 2022. 11. 2. 20:33

팀원이 로그인 회원가입 버튼을 만들어달라고 해서 추가했다.

행렬에 대해 조금 익숙해진 터, 사용한 코드들의 큰 개념을 한 번 정리해놔야 할 필요성을 느꼈다.

 

display: inline;

줄바꿈 없이 순서대로 한 줄에 보이도록 해줌

width height 속성을 지정해도 무시하는 특징이 있음.

float: left;

비슷한데 한줄로 착착 쌓음. 이렇게 사용하면 display랑 다르게 묶이지 않고 독립적인 영역으로 사용 가능...?

 

display: block;

다른 엘리먼트들을 다른 줄로 밀어내고 혼자 한 줄을 차지.

 

display: inline-block;

inline처럼 순서대로 한 줄에 보이도록 해주면서 block처럼 width height 지정도 가능해지는 하이브리드 코드.

 

display: flex;

순서대로 한 줄에 보이도록 해줌.

해당 div가 flex container이며, 내부 div들이 flex item임을 정의해줌.

flex-direction: column;
justify-content: center;
align-items: center;

display: felx와 세트

 

flex-wrap: wrap;

display: flex로 길이를 벗어나는 경우 벗어나지 않도록 잡아줌.

 

위 코드들만 있으면 웬만한 행렬 문제는 해결 가능한 것 같다.

 

 


 

 

한편, 토이 프로젝트 개인 결과물을 완성하고 나니 인터넷에 띄워보고 싶어졌다.

그러기 위해 git bash를 사용하던 중 오류가 발생.

문제

port 22: connection refused라는 오류 발생

구글링 결과 sudo 명령어로 ssh server를 설치하라는 해결책을 발견.

sudo 명령어를 입력하니 이번엔 sudo: command not found가 발생.

다시 구글링 해 찾은 방법을 사용하니 이번엔 apt-get: command not found가 발생.

그걸 해결하는 방법을 찾으니 sudo를 입력하라는 해결책을 발견.

...?

 

그러나 해결책은 너무도 간단했다.

ssh -i (키페어 끌어넣기) ubuntu@(인스턴스 '퍼블릭 IPv4 주소' 붙여넣기)

에서 퍼블릭 IPv4 주소를 한 칸 띄어쓰기해서 오류가 난 것이었다...

추가 주의사항

git bash 재실행할 때 ssh -i (키페어 끌어넣기) ubuntu@(인스턴스 '퍼블릭 IPv4 주소' 붙여넣기)로 들어가서 app.py실행해야 됨.

내 컴퓨터에서 cd로 타고들어가서 실행 x

그리고 새폴더를 만들고, 파일질라를 이용해서 그 폴더에 자료 넣는 게 깔끔함.

'일지' 카테고리의 다른 글

서버 성능?  (0) 2022.11.06
또 다시 줄 이슈  (0) 2022.11.03
반응형 웹으로 바꾸기 (허접함 주의)  (0) 2022.11.01
D-day 구현하기  (0) 2022.10.31
문자열 치환, ...처리  (0) 2022.10.29
Comments